MpShHook.dll file information

The process Shell Execution Monitor belongs to the software Windows Defender or MpShHook.dll or Shell Execution Monitor or Sony Ericsson Device Data by Microsoft Corporation (www.microsoft.com).

Description: File MpShHook.dll is located in a subfolder of "C:\Program Files" or sometimes in a subfolder of C:\Windows. Known file sizes on Windows XP are 83,224 bytes (73% of all occurrence), 81,616 bytes, 160,016 bytes.
This is a special .dll file (Dynamic Link Library), which starts automatically when programs are launched. So it can monitor or manipulate all of your program starts. The program is not visible. MpShHook.dll is certified by a trustworthy company. The file is not a Windows core file. The process can be uninstalled in the Control Panel. It monitors program starts. Therefore the technical security rating is 42% dangerous, however also read the users reviews.

Important: Some malware camouflage themselves as MpShHook.dll, particularly if they are located in c:\windows or c:\windows\system32 folder.
